ABSTRACT: The knowledge of the
geodetic reference datum of maps or data is required for their use in a GIS.
Many older maps are lacking this information, making their use cumbersome. The
availability of an aerial coverage at high resolution of Burundi and digital
elevation model, based on a novel geodetic network, all calculated on the WGS84
datum, allows to calculate the datum applicable to older maps, for instance the
regular 1/50k map of the country. The method, based on the difference in
geocentric coordinates between points common to the two systems, yields: Δx =
-156.71 ± 10.2 m, .Δy = -3.26 ± 13.2 m, .Δz = -290.77 ± 21.06 m, well in
keeping with older values proposed by the NGA.
